		<description>Corruption will be forever part of India. 
A recent case, I refer to the Malaysian Double Track Project - Seremban to Gemas, whereby IRCON international was awarded this project by the Gov of Malaysia. 
In the signaling package, a sum of 1 core was paid to IRCON MD to obtain this contract. A &quot;one man&quot; show company &quot;Westinghouse Malaysia&quot; got this job after bribing IRCON Officials in India.
This one man show company hardly has even a decent office and capability.
This shows, corruption will be part and parcel of India.</description>
